Sr. Software Engineer (Back-End)
Job Summary
We are looking for a Software Engineer to work with our main SaaS platform.
Job Description
- You have a good understanding of Object Oriented Programming concepts
- You have experience working on Distributed Systems / Microservices
- You should be able to produce clean, efficient code based on specifications
- You will be working with an existing product
- Knowledge of and adherence to best practices for writing maintainable code, unit-testing is a must
- You possess analytical and problem solving skills
- You should be able to work independently as a contributing member in a high-paced and focused team.
Requirements
- Bachelor Degree in Computer Science or Information Technology, or equal experience
- At least Five years of Experience writing programs in C# .NET Framework, or Java
- At least Two years of Experience working with MongoDB or other NoSQL
- Able to learn and understand various API services
- Self-motivated, eager to solve problems and drive to completion, willing to work with others. We encourage pair programming and we require collaboration on design, code reviews, and testing.
- Hybrid engineer, able to design and implement your own code as well as review, test, and write test automation for other engineers’ code.
- Like to explore new technologies and programming techniques, and a “willing to learn” attitude.
- Fluent in written and spoken English
Benefits
- Modern Office in CBD Location easy to get by public transportation
- Health focused office enviroment, LEED Green Building certified.
- Competitive salary based on experience
- Annual performance based bonus
- 10 days annual leave
- Medical insurance
- Flexible working hours
- Jetts Gym membership
- Work with a great team with A-players from around the world
- Free Snacks and beverages
- Annual company trips, and frequent company events
This role is open for both Thai and non-Thai candidates – we can provide full VISA sponsorship if required
To apply, please attach your CV/Resume